Spatial Topologies (2014)

“Spatial Topologies” (2014) was a collaborative project and exhibition by four diverse artist. The artist are Brian Harnetty, a sound artist from Ohio; Astrid Kaemmerling, a painter and installation artist from North Rhine Westfalia, Germany; Josh Ottum, a musician from California; and Jena Seiler, a video and installation artist from New Mexico. The exhibition focused on process and site-specific renderings, while exploring (de)generative characteristics of spatial experience. Viewers were invited to immerse themselves in the artists’ production and exploration of place. These experiments manifest themselves in visual depictions of urban intersections, aural documentation of the Little Cities of Black Diamond, and physical transformations of the gallery space itself.
